    Inverted flare fittings and double flare fittings are both crucial components in various hydraulic systems, including brake, power steering, and fuel lines. Here’s a simplified explanation of the differences between them:

    What Are Inverted Flare Fittings?

    Application: Commonly used in hydraulic brake, power steering, fuel lines, and transmission cooler lines.

    Features: Inverted flare fittings are known for their affordability and reusability. They are particularly noted for their excellent resistance to vibration, which is crucial in many hydraulic systems.

    Design: These fittings have a machined male connector with a 42° seat and a flared male tubing with a 45° seat. The female side features a 42° seat that creates a sealing surface. The threads are internal, providing protection and a mechanically strong bond when connected.

    Standards: They meet the SAE J512 standard, ensuring compatibility and reliability in various applications.

    What Are Double Flare Fittings?

    Application: Ideal for systems that require frequent tightening and untightening.

    Advantages: The design of double flare fittings allows the fitting to move against a folded section of the pipe, reducing wear on the outer pipe wall. This feature is particularly beneficial in applications where the fitting needs to be adjusted or removed frequently.

    Pressure Rating: It’s important to note that there is no difference in pressure rating between single and double flares.
